Now it's up to Juventus and Napoli. The victories of Rome, Lazio and Fiorentina, combined with those of Milan, Inter and Atalanta on Saturday, mean that the big names are all in full loot, which is why the bianconeri and azzurri cannot be wrong. It won't be an easy mid-August for them, given that Sassuolo and Verona promise battle, but the counting of points has already started inexorably and nobody wants to fall behind. Sunday in the championship did not give away twists, at least in terms of results: Fiorentina and Lazio, in fact, had a much harder time than expected to beat Cremonese (3-2 with a final save from Radu) and Bologna (2-1 after remaining in 10 players due to the expulsion of Maximiano ). The most brilliant success is instead that of Mourinho's Rome, because Salerno's 1-0 is undoubtedly tight for her, as demonstrated by the numerous goalscorings failed by Zaniolo, Dybala and company, before the decisive goal by Cristante (34 ') which was worth 3 golden points.

Juventus-Sassuolo (20 pm, Dazn). Allegrai wand i of him: "I see too many triumphalisms, here we are all in discussion"

There is great anticipation for Juventus' seasonal debut and the weekend's results, if possible, have only increased it. The match against Sassuolo is the exam that everyone is waiting for to understand if the Lady, after the summer restyling, can seriously return to compete for the Scudetto, or if the road is still long. In this sense, the market tells us that the picture is not complete, as demonstrated by the work in progress to get to Depay (from Spain they tell of an imminent agreement) and Paredes (here everything depends on the transfers of Rabiot and Arthur), in the meantime, however, the bianconeri must make a virtue of necessity and bring home the first 3 season points. “We are Juventus and we have a duty to aim to win, but I see too many triumphalisms and I don't like this, we must know that it will be difficult and change our attitude – growled Allegri -. Only in this way, one step at a time, can we close the gap with the Milanese. We have to work on our attitude, because we didn't win a tackle or an aerial duel against Atletico Madrid. No one gives us anything, here we are all in discussion…”. Vitriolic words of a technician under pressure, aware that this year the tolerance towards him will be very different from last year: the results will be decisive for everyone, but he is undoubtedly the special observer.

Juventus-Sassuolo, the formations. Allegri, in an emergency, focuses on Di Maria and Vlahovic

Allegri hoped to be able to count on an almost complete squad for this debut, but instead he will have to do without very important players such as Pogba e Szczesny, as well as the suspended Kean and Rabiot. In any case, the anti-Sassuolo eleven will still be respectable, for a 4-4-1-1 with Perin in goal, Danilo, Bonucci, Bremer and De Sciglio in defense, Cuadrado, Zakaria, Locatelli and McKennie in midfield, Di Maria behind the lone striker Vlahovic. Problems also for Dionisi, who after the bad elimination from the Italian Cup by Modena will seek redemption without Traoré, Maxime Lopez (suspended) and, above all, with Raspadori on the bench, evidently too much distracted by market rumours. The neroverde 4-3-3 will thus see Consigli between the posts, Muldur, Erlic, Ferrari and Kyriakopoulos in the back, Frattesi, Henrique and Thorstvedt in the midfield, Berardi, Pinamonti and Ceide in attack.

Verona-Naples (18 pm, Dazn). Spalletti puts his hands forward: "A new cycle begins, I don't insure anything"

The other challenge of the day is that of the Bentegodi, where a very interesting Verona-Napoli will be staged. The spotlights are inevitably on the Azzurri, called to start strong to put an end to a very complicated summer, the result of a transfer market that has literally overturned Spalletti's squad. The farewells of Koulibaly, Insigne, Mertens, Ospina and, most likely, Fabian Ruiz, have not been digested by the square, even if now De Laurentiis it is moving significantly. In addition to Kim, Kvaratskhelia and Simeone, high caliber elements such as Keylor Navas, Raspadori and Ndombele could arrive, yet the widespread feeling is that Napoli has undergone a significant downsizing and Spalletti, in his first conference of the season, has done nothing to dispel it. "If we talk about Naples, ambitions are always high, given that we have a city behind us that deserves it, then the idea that I am the one to lay the foundations for the coming years is a responsibility that I gladly take on and that stimulates me a lot - the thought of the blue coach -. But then I can't assure anything and it is clear that you play to collect the maximum available, as they always say…”. In short, his Napoli 2.0 is still to be evaluated, but a victory in Verona would help a lot to look to the future with more serenity, making even the transfer market end less anxious.

Verona-Naples, the formations. Spalletti, waiting for the market, relies on the survivors

It will be a Naples old fashioned what we will see tonight, except for Kim and Kvaratskhelia, now available for weeks. Spalletti hopes to be able to embrace other new signings soon, in the meantime he is betting on 9/11 already present last season, for a 4-3-3 made up of Meret in goal, Di Lorenzo, Rrahmani, Kim and Mario Rui in defense, Anguissa, Lobotka and Zielinski in midfield, Lozano, Osimhen and Kvaratskhelia in attack. Various news also for Cioffi, his first in Serie A on the Verona bench after the bad defeat in the Coppa Italia against Bari. The coach, forced to do less than the suspended Veloso and Ceccherini and with Barak left on the bench waiting to clarify the his future will focus on a 3-5-2 with Montipò in goal, Dawidowicz, Gunter and Coppola in the back, Faraoni, Tameze, Hongla, Ilic and Lazovic in the midfield, Lasagna and Henry as an offensive pair.
